Transaction 43d64acdd011512f1c320b2f8bf1d501bc22bb7476ee53e8bba2a743cf4bcf12
1 Input
1 Output
-
43d64acdd011512f1c320b2f8bf1d501bc22bb7476ee53e8bba2a743cf4bcf12:0
- value
- 526482
- script pubkey
- OP_0 OP_PUSHBYTES_20 444db8dc0f9ffa37b160e89d7716a2b27f0f7c4d
- address
- bc1qg3xm3hq0nlar0vtqazwhw94zkfls7lzdlksh7v